You just can never escape ride closures in Disneyland. Sometimes, rides go down temporarily for issues. Other times, rides close for routine maintenance.
However, Disneyland Resort has plans to close multiple attractions this spring, including “it’s a small world,” Guardians of the Galaxy: Mission Breakout, and The Disneyland Story Presenting Great Moments with Mr. Lincoln. Well, now, it’s time to add ANOTHER ride to the list that will be temporarily closing soon, and it’s another popular one: Indiana Jones Adventure.

At Destination D23 last year, it was announced that a Tropical Americas-themed land would take the place of DinoLand U.S.A. Well, at D23 this past August, we got more details about what is to come when this new area, now named Pueblo Esperanza. This new land is set to open by 2027 as construction will be done in different phases. This new land will feature three brand-new rides! But there is one ride that we have some bad news about.
